An Assistant Professor—often the first rung on the tenure-track ladder in higher education—combines teaching, research, and institutional service to build a lasting academic career. This position, meaning an early-career faculty member with potential for promotion, emerged in the early 20th century in U.S. universities to formalize faculty hierarchies amid expanding enrollment. Today, Assistant Professors teach courses, publish scholarly work, and engage in service, typically evaluated over 5-7 years for tenure, a permanent contract granting academic freedom.
In global contexts, the role adapts to local systems. For instance, it parallels France's 'maître de conférences' (MCF), an entry habilitated position requiring a PhD and competitive qualification.

Required academic qualifications: A doctoral degree (PhD or equivalent) in the relevant discipline from an accredited institution is essential. For French Polynesia positions, French doctoral recognition via HDR (Habilitation à Diriger des Recherches) preparation is key.
Research focus or expertise needed: Demonstrated productivity, such as 4-6 publications in high-impact journals, conference presentations, and a clear research agenda aligned with institutional priorities like sustainability.
Preferred experience: 1-3 years postdoctoral or lecturing, successful grant applications (e.g., €50,000+), and teaching portfolios with positive evaluations.
Skills and competencies: Excellent pedagogical skills, data analysis proficiency, bilingual communication (French/English), cultural sensitivity, time management, and collaborative teamwork. Adaptability to remote island settings enhances candidacy.

French Polynesia, a French overseas collectivity in the South Pacific, centers higher education at the Université de la Polynésie Française (UPF) in Punaauia, Tahiti, founded in 1999 with 4,000 students. Assistant Professor jobs here emphasize fields like marine biology, environmental management, law, and tourism, reflecting the region's biodiversity and economy. Recruited via France's national process (GALAXIE portal), these roles offer MCF-equivalent status with expatriate perks: base salary €2,800 net/month plus 50% indemnity for high living costs, totaling €60,000+ annually.
Cultural context includes integrating Polynesian perspectives, with opportunities in interdisciplinary Pacific studies. Recent trends show demand for AI and climate research, echoing France's initiatives.
From Assistant Professor, tenure leads to Associate (after CNU qualification), then Full Professor. Success hinges on consistent output: aim for book chapters, international collaborations, and student success metrics.
